Abstract:
In order to better realize the status and its dynamic variations of principal nutrition in Nanping tobacco-growing soil, and to provide the basis for soil conservation and tobacco balanced fertilization. The status and variations of soil nitrogen, phosphorus and potassium were analyzed base on the data of the soil survey of Nanping tobacco-planting area. The results showed that the average content of total nitrogen, phosphorus and potassium in Nanping tobacco-growing soil were (1.61±0.47) g/kg, (0.57±0.31) g/kg, and (16.34±6.31) g/kg respectively, the average content of alkali-hydrolyzable nitrogen, available phosphorus and potassium were (146.05±38.76) mg/kg, (28.80±26.11) mg/kg, and (90.02±52.12) mg/kg respectively. The variation of the soil phosphorus and potassium was great; the variation of nitrogen was medium. There were positive correlations between the soil alkali-hydradyzble nitrogen content and the texture, the organic matter and the nitrogen content, the available phosphorus, pH and the total phosphorus content. The content of available potassium had extremely significant positive correlations with pH, texture, organic matter, total potassium and the content of slow-release potassium. The nitrogen and potassium supply of soil showed a lower tendency, but the phosphorus supply of soil showed a higher tendency, especially for the old tobacco-growing areas which were long-term continuous tobacco-planting. Considering the soil conservation and quality tobacco production, the flue-cured tobacco production in Nanping should apply dolomite to increase the pH of soil, apply more organic matter and K fertilizer, control the content of nitrogen at current season, and reduce phosphate fertilizer generally, but the phosphate fertilizer application shall be regarded when the content of the available phosphorus was less than 10mg/kg.
